1. ICP Ranks Second in Global On-Chain Activity (28 July 2026)
Overview: Data from Chainspect shows ICP processed 133 million transactions in a single day, achieving an average throughput of 1,538 TPS with instant finality. This performance placed it second globally, ahead of networks like BNB and TRON. The scalability is driven by over 49 independent subnets enabling horizontal scaling. The surge comes ahead of key 2026 roadmap milestones, including "Mission 70" to reduce token inflation and sovereign subnets for enterprise AI.
What this means: This is bullish for ICP because sustained high throughput demonstrates robust network capacity, a critical foundation for hosting full-stack dApps and AI workloads. However, the token's price remains disconnected from this activity, trading down over 90% from its all-time high, highlighting a narrative-adoption gap that needs to close for a sustained re-rating.

2. ICP MCP Server Preview for AI Agents (23 July 2026)
Overview: DFINITY released a preview of its Model Context Protocol (MCP) server, creating a direct interface between AI agents and ICP's smart contracts (canisters). The server allows agents to discover canisters, resolve user identities, query data, and execute methods without custom integrations for each step.
What this means: This is a neutral-to-bullish development for ICP as it reduces friction for building AI-driven applications on-chain, potentially attracting more developers. The long-term impact depends entirely on whether developers adopt this tool to build and deploy meaningful agent-based applications that drive real network usage.

3. Cloud Engines Launch for Sovereign Infrastructure (21 July 2026)
Overview: ICP introduced "Cloud Engines," a new infrastructure class designed to be immune to data center outages and geopolitical conflicts. It allows enterprises to configure private, compliant subnets, maintaining the network's tamper-proof guarantees. This launch is part of a push for the "2026 autonomous economy" and follows the establishment of national sovereign subnets in Switzerland and Pakistan.
What this means: This is bullish for ICP as it directly targets the high-value enterprise and government cloud market, diversifying its use cases beyond DeFi. Success in this sector could create a new, substantial demand driver for ICP tokens, especially if the promised 20% revenue burn mechanism from Cloud Engines is widely adopted.
